Uğur Dağdelen (3 October 1973 – 24 September 2015) was a Turkish professional footballer from Amasya. He played for several clubs in Turkey in addition to the Turkey national football team.

Club career[]

Dağdelen played for Karabükspor, Bursaspor and Samsunspor in the Turkish Süper Lig, appearing in more than 140 league matches and scoring more than 30 goals.[1]

International career[]

Dağdelen made one appearance for the full Turkey national football team in a friendly against Russia on April 22, 1998.[1]
